1. Embedded Problems
By Federico Biancuzzi
Federico Biancuzzi interviews Barnaby Jack to discuss the vector rewrite =
attack, which architectures are vulnerable, how to defend the integrity o=
f the exception vector table, some firmware extraction methods, and what =
bad things you can do on a cheap SOHO router.

1. Todd Miller Sudo Ptrace API Local Privilege Escalation Vulnerability
BugTraq ID: 24287
Remote: No
Date Published: 2007-06-04
Relevant URL: http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/24287
Summary:
The 'sudo' utility and the 'ptrace' call are prone to a local privilege-e=
scalation vulnerability.=20

An attacker can exploit this issue to execute arbitrary commands with sup=
eruser privileges. Successfully exploiting this issue will result in the =
complete compromise of affected computers.

4. Util-linux Login Security Bypass Vulnerability
BugTraq ID: 24321
Remote: Yes
Date Published: 2007-06-05
Relevant URL: http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/24321
Summary:
The 'login' utility (in 'util-linux') is prone to a security-bypass vulne=
rability because the utility fails to properly validate user privileges.

Exploiting this issue can allow an attacker to bypass certain security re=
strictions and potentially gain unauthorized access.

Versions prior to 'util-linux' 2.12 are vulnerable.

5. Mozilla Firefox Beatnik Extension Remote Script Code Execution Vulnera=
bility
BugTraq ID: 24324
Remote: Yes
Date Published: 2007-06-05
Relevant URL: http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/24324
Summary:
A remote code-execution vulnerability affects the Beatnik extension for M=
ozilla Firefox because the application fails to validate input errors whe=
n processing RSS feeds.
=20
An attacker may leverage this issue to execute arbitrary code in the cont=
ext of the user account running the affected extension. This may facilita=
te cross-site scripting as well as a compromise of an affected computer.

Beatnik 1.0 is vulnerable; other versions may also be affected.

6. W3M Browser InputAnswer Format String Vulnerability
BugTraq ID: 24332
Remote: Yes
Date Published: 2007-06-05
Relevant URL: http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/24332
Summary:
W3M is prone to a format-string vulnerability because it fails to properl=
y sanitize user-supplied input before passing it as the format specifier =
to a formatted-printing function.

An attack can exploit this issue to execute arbitrary machine code in the=
 context of the user running the affected browser. A successful attack wi=
ll compromise the application. Failed attempts may cause denial-of-servic=
e conditions.

Versions prior to W3M  0.5.2 are vulnerable.

7. LHA Insecure Temporary File Creation Vulnerability
BugTraq ID: 24336
Remote: No
Date Published: 2007-06-05
Relevant URL: http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/24336
Summary:
The 'lha' program creates temporary files in an insecure manner.

An attacker with local access could potentially exploit this issue to per=
form symlink attacks, overwriting arbitrary files in the context of the a=
ffected application.=20

Successfully mounting a symlink attack may allow the attacker to overwrit=
e or corrupt sensitive files, which may result in a denial of service. Ot=
her attacks may also be possible.

12. Todd Miller Sudo Kerberos Authentication Local Authentication Bypass =
Weakness
BugTraq ID: 24368
Remote: No
Date Published: 2007-06-07
Relevant URL: http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/24368
Summary:
The 'sudo' utility is prone to a local authentication-bypass weakness whe=
n used in conjunction with Kerberos. Attackers must first gain local, int=
eractive access to a computer running 'sudo' configured to authenticate v=
ia Kerberos. They may do this by exploiting other latent vulnerabilities.

Successfully exploiting this issue allows local attackers to bypass sudo'=
s authentication prompt, allowing them to perform actions that are grante=
d to users via the 'sudoers' file.

This issue affects 'sudo' 1.6.8p12; other versions may also be affected.

16. Novell NetWare Modular Authentication Service Local Information Discl=
osure Vulnerability
BugTraq ID: 24405
Remote: No
Date Published: 2007-06-07
Relevant URL: http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/24405
Summary:
Novell NetWare Modular Authentication Service (NMAS) is prone to a local =
information-disclosure vulnerability because 'NMASINST' dumps the admin a=
ccount and password into a log file in clear text.

The flaw presents itself in NMAS 3.1.2; prior versions are also affected.

18. OpenOffice RTF File Parser Buffer Overflow Vulnerability
BugTraq ID: 24450
Remote: Yes
Date Published: 2007-06-12
Relevant URL: http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/24450
Summary:
OpenOffice is prone to a remote heap-based buffer-overflow vulnerability =
because the application fails to bounds-check user-supplied data before c=
opying it into an insufficiently sized buffer.

Remote attackers may exploit this issue by enticing victims into opening =
maliciously crafted RTF files.

An attacker can exploit this issue to execute arbitrary code within the c=
ontext of the affected application. Failed exploit attempts will result i=
n a denial of service.

19. EXIF Library EXIF File Processing Integer Overflow Vulnerability
BugTraq ID: 24461
Remote: Yes
Date Published: 2007-06-13
Relevant URL: http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/24461
Summary:
The 'libexif' library is reported prone to an integer-overflow vulnerabil=
ity. Reportedly, the issue presents itself when the affected library is p=
rocessing malformed EXIF files. =20
=20
Attackers may leverage this issue to execute arbitrary code in the contex=
t of an application that is linked to the vulnerable library. Failed expl=
oit attempts will likely result in denial-of-service conditions.

This issue affects 'libexif' 0.6.13 to 0.6.15; other versions may also be=
 affected.
